FLORENCE, S.C. -- The Anderson College softball team finished the three-day Francis Marion Invitational with a record of 2-3. On Friday, Anderson beat Bluefield State, 4-2 and lost to North Florida, 12-0. In the Bluefield game, Anderson pitcher Stephanie Griffis allowed just four hits and struck out 10. Anderson's offense was led by Jessica Hoffman (3-3) and Carolyn Smith (2-3). In Saturday action, Anderson lost to Augusta State, 10-4. On Sunday, Anderson beat North Carolina Central, 8-2 and lost to Lander 10-9 in nine innings. Rachelle Lawrence and Maranda Passmore had two hits apiece for Anderson in the North Carolina Central game. Anderson is now 12-21 overall this season. Anderson College Softball Season Statistics
